Title: Byung Yeol Kim: Innovator in Flexible Printed Circuit Board Technology
Introduction
Byung Yeol Kim is a prominent inventor based in Hwaseong-si, South Korea. He has made significant contributions to the field of flexible printed circuit boards, holding a total of 15 patents. His innovative designs have advanced the technology used in electronic devices, making them more efficient and versatile.
Latest Patents
Among his latest patents is a flexible printed circuit board comprising a power transmission line. This invention features a first power line formed on one surface of a first dielectric layer and a second power line on a second dielectric layer. The design includes an overlapping area where the two power lines connect through via holes, enhancing the functionality of the circuit board. Another notable patent is a flexible circuit board that includes both vertical and horizontal sections. This design allows for the first and second signal lines to be aligned vertically while also providing a mechanism for changing their positions through via holes.
